Phlebotomist Salary in Arlington, TX
How much does a Phlebotomist make in Arlington, TX?
In Arlington, TX, a Phlebotomist earns a competitive salary. The average annual salary for this role is around $37,306. This figure can vary based on experience and specific employer. Many Phlebotomists start with salaries between $31,100 and $34,700. As they gain more experience, salaries can increase to between $38,300 and $44,300.
Several factors can influence a Phlebotomist's salary in Arlington. These include the type of healthcare facility, level of education, and additional certifications. Phlebotomists who work in hospitals or large clinics often earn higher salaries than those in smaller practices. Those with extra certifications, such as in phlebotomy techniques or patient care, may also see higher pay. Experience plays a key role, with more experienced Phlebotomists earning more.
